We had no issue getting our 42' 5th wheel into this park due to it being part of the local rodeo arena. This beautiful little city campground has several sites with water and electric. The site we were at had both 30 and 50 amp service. There was a dump station, but it was only for grey water (sewage as they called it). The signage was very clear that black water (septic as they called it) was not to be emptied there.
There were two other campers that appear to be for electrical line workers that were in the area. They appeared to be staying longer than the free 3 day limit. If you want to stay more than 3 days, there was a number to call to register. I am unsure what the rate is for a longer duration.
We had good Verizon and AT&T voice with 4G data for each. The water pressure was about 60psi. We didn't have any issues with the 50 amp service. Google satellite view gives a good depiction of how the space is laid out. Overall this was a quiet campground in a nice little town.

This was a welcome surprise, a free campground with electric and water hook-ups courtesy of the city of O'Neill, Nebraska. Another reason this state is known as "Nebraska Nice" There are probably around 20 sites, a few with picnic tables. Just to the north of the c/g is a trail that goes for several hundred miles for hiking or bike riding across the state. We walked about a mile of it and we passed cows and farms and it was quite pleasant. There is the option to leave a donation, but one is allowed to stay for up to 3 nights free, then it is $10 per night. Free first 3 nights; then $10/night. At south end of town, on SH181. (N42.4512 W98.645) A nice place, if a tad rundown. Horse arena adjacent to camping area. Camping sites are next to a small creek with trees for shade. Camping sites have water and electricity, and there is a dump station, at the far end of the camping loop. Restrooms with showers.
